Output 85d153984751849d4c9824e37a80f32a3bdce8feeb1ca4f50b63f73efd48af46:2

value
1555172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855ed7a49c5ef52a9b7867ba1f3c3df9f9c64e3a OP_EQUAL
address
3DrDQpVLtj7VLM8JanYfubyspwHtHmUiAu
transaction
85d153984751849d4c9824e37a80f32a3bdce8feeb1ca4f50b63f73efd48af46
spent
true